KAPANUI COLLISION.

CAPTAIN SOUTHGATE CHARGED WITH MANSLAUGHTER.

(Per Press Aseocdation.) Auobland, last night. inquest on the reoovered bodies of the viotims of the Kapauui disaster, which occurred in the harbor off North Head on the night of December 23rd, concluded to-day. The jury brought in a verdict that the death of Clarke was due to crushing, while that of Heavey and Fietoher was due to drowning, and that the deaths of all three were occasioned by the improper navigation of Jame 3 Southgate, then captain of tbe Kapanui. Captain Smibgale was then arrested on a charge of manslaughter, and was taken before a Justice of the Peace, and released on bail, to appear before the Polioe Court to-morrow morning.
